Steven Gerrard was given a reminder of the lack of quality he has at Murray Park this afternoon with Dundee United winning a friendly match 4-1.

Although it was labelled a B team match summer signing Calvin Bassey was include alongside Young McCrorie who is tipped to become Scotland’s greatest ever defender.

Summer 2019 signings Jordan Jones and Greg Stewart were also in the side confirming that they aren’t in Mister Gerrard’s top team plans.

While Celtic, Nice and Lyon used a full squad of 25 players at the Veolia Tournament Gerrard stuck rigidly to a trusted group of 15 players during both matches with the others making up the numbers.

An 18 man squad was kept back for tonight’s home friendly against Motherwell with the opening SPFL match just 10 days away.

Since last season ended Gerrard has added Bassey and Jon McLaughlin to his squad with Andy Halliday, Wes Foderingham, Jon Flanagan, Matt Polster, Sheyi Ojo, Florian Kamberi, Jason Holt and Jordan Rossiter.
